Impact on mortgages and refinancing
Mortgage lenders rely on precise appraisals to determine loan-to-value ratios and underwriting decisions. When Home Appraisals Services are thorough, they reduce the chances of last‑minute valuation disparities that can derail deals. For homeowners refinancing, a solid appraisal reassures lenders and can unlock more favourable terms if the property has appreciated. In both scenarios, a well-documented appraisal helps align expectations between borrowers, lenders, and sellers, supporting a fair, transparent funding process and mitigating future disputes over value.
Preparing for your appraisal day
Preparation matters when booking an appraisal. Clear communication about property features, recent improvements, and relevant documents speeds up the process and improves accuracy. Ensure access to all living spaces, provide maintenance records, and highlight any issues that could influence value. Clean, well-lit photos and a tidy exterior help the appraiser assess condition. Understanding the scope of work and being available to answer questions can streamline the report, enabling a smoother transaction and a more reliable result for stakeholders involved.
